Hitching Post Tap House Crowns Trivia League Winners

Belle Fourche News Events Other Local News

BELLE FOURCHE—Eight weeks of Trivia League has come to an end at the Hitching Post Tap House. Finals were held on the evening of March 20.

Each week trivia teams answered three rounds of questions worth 10 points each for a total of 30 possible points. During the final round each team was able to bet points earned from the night for the final question. Weekly winners received 15 percent off their tab at the Tap House along with a $15 gift card to a local Belle Fourche Business.

On the final night, teams were able to bet all points earned during the entire series on one final question. Betting was a Jeopardy-style winner take all system. After making the decision for how many hard earned points to risk from those that each team spent eight weeks earning, it came down to one final question.

In the end, one team came out on top by knowing that March was named after the Roman God of War. The team Just Here for the Pizza made up of Shannon and Neilon Millar won the Trivia League title for the second year in a row. Shannon explained that they don’t do anything special to prepare for trivia. Neilon added that they have tried studying in the past, but it didn’t really work because you never know what will be asked. “I would suggest watching a lot of YouTube or reels because you never know,” said Shannon.

Thursday night trivia was a popular way for the community to spend the evening. “This was our best season so far, we had more teams than we have ever had at any previous Trivia League,” explained Amanda Kramp, Owner. “We had a great turnout almost every night we had full tables. The bar was packed pretty much every Thursday and that was where it was difficult to find seats sometimes, which was really cool!”
